Indications
DYTOR 40 MG is primarily indicated for the management of hypertension, which is a condition characterized by elevated blood pressure levels. It is also used in the treatment of heart failure, where it helps to improve the heart’s efficiency and reduce symptoms associated with this condition. Additionally, DYTOR may be prescribed for certain cases of edema, which is the accumulation of excess fluid in the body, particularly in patients with renal or hepatic issues.
Mechanism of Action
The active ingredient in DYTOR 40 MG is torsemide, a loop diuretic that works by inhibiting the sodium-potassium-chloride co-transporter in the thick ascending limb of the loop of Henle in the nephron. This inhibition leads to increased excretion of sodium, chloride, and water, resulting in diuresis (increased urine production). By promoting fluid loss, DYTOR effectively reduces blood volume and, consequently, blood pressure. The reduction in fluid overload also aids in alleviating symptoms of heart failure.
Pharmacological Properties
DYTOR exhibits a rapid onset of action, typically within one hour of administration, with peak effects occurring around two hours post-dose. The duration of action can last up to 6 to 8 hours, making it suitable for once-daily dosing in most cases. Torsemide is well absorbed from the gastrointestinal tract, with a bioavailability of approximately 80% to 90%. It is extensively bound to plasma proteins, primarily albumin, and is metabolized in the liver, with renal excretion of both unchanged drug and metabolites. The pharmacokinetics of torsemide may be altered in patients with renal impairment, necessitating dosage adjustments.
Contraindications
DYTOR 40 MG is contraindicated in patients with known hypersensitivity to torsemide or any of its components. It should not be used in individuals with anuria (the inability to produce urine) or severe electrolyte imbalances, particularly hypokalemia (low potassium levels) or hyponatremia (low sodium levels). Caution is advised in patients with a history of gout, as torsemide may elevate uric acid levels, potentially exacerbating the condition.
Side Effects
Common side effects associated with DYTOR 40 MG include electrolyte imbalances, particularly hypokalemia, which can lead to muscle cramps, weakness, and arrhythmias. Other potential side effects may include dizziness, headache, gastrointestinal disturbances such as nausea and diarrhea, and increased urination. Rare but serious side effects may involve allergic reactions, hepatic dysfunction, and renal impairment. Patients should be monitored regularly for any adverse effects, particularly during the initiation of therapy.
Dosage and Administration
The recommended starting dose of DYTOR 40 MG for adults with hypertension is typically 10 to 20 mg once daily, with adjustments made based on the patient’s response and blood pressure readings. In cases of heart failure, the dosage may be increased to 40 mg once daily or more, depending on clinical response and tolerability. For edema, the dosing regimen may vary, and healthcare providers will tailor the dosage to the individual patient’s needs. Interactions
DYTOR 40 MG may interact with several medications, which can either enhance its effects or increase the risk of adverse reactions. Concurrent use with other diuretics or antihypertensive agents may lead to additive hypotensive effects. Non-steroidal anti-inflammatory drugs (NSAIDs) can reduce the diuretic effect of torsemide and may also lead to renal impairment in susceptible individuals. Additionally, the use of torsemide with medications that affect electrolyte levels, such as corticosteroids, can increase the risk of electrolyte imbalances. Precautions
Patients taking DYTOR 40 MG should be monitored for signs of dehydration and electrolyte imbalances, particularly hypokalemia. Regular blood tests may be necessary to assess kidney function and electrolyte levels. Special caution should be exercised in patients with pre-existing renal or hepatic impairment, as they may be more susceptible to the adverse effects of torsemide. Additionally, elderly patients may require careful monitoring due to an increased risk of falls and dehydration. Clinical Studies
Clinical studies have demonstrated the efficacy of DYTOR 40 MG in managing hypertension and heart failure. In randomized controlled trials, torsemide has been shown to effectively lower blood pressure and improve clinical outcomes in patients with heart failure when compared to placebo. Studies have also indicated that torsemide may be beneficial in reducing hospitalizations due to heart failure exacerbations.
